日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程语言 > java >内容正文

java

Java SE 01 Java概述

發布時間:2023/12/20 java 38 豆豆
生活随笔 收集整理的這篇文章主要介紹了 Java SE 01 Java概述 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

Java SE01

一、Java概述

1.Java語言的定位

Java 是一種功能強大和多用途的編程語言,可用于開發運行在移動設備、臺式計算機以及服務器端的軟件。

2.Java的特點

Java 是簡單的(simple)、面向對象的(object oriented )、分布式的(distributed )、解釋型的(interpreted )、健壯的(robust)、安全的(secure)、體系結構中立的(architectureneutral)、可移植的(portable)、高性能的(high performance)、多線程的( multithreaded ) 和動態的(dynamic)。

3.Java語言跨平臺原理

跨平臺:通過Java語言編寫的應用程序在不同的系統平臺上都可以運行。
只要在需要運行Java應用程序的操作系統上,先安裝一個Java虛擬機(JVM Java Virtual Machine)即可。由JVM來負責Java程序在該系統上的運行。

4.JDK和JRE

3.Java目前的版本

Java 是一個全面且功能強大的語言,可用于多種用途。Java 有三個版本:
JavaSE(Java Standard Edition):標準版
是為開發普通桌面和商務應用程序提供的解決方案
該技術體系是其他兩者的基礎,可以完成一些桌面應用程序的開發
JavaEE(Java Enterprise Edition):企業版
是為開發企業環境下的應用程序提供的一套解決方案
該技術體系中包含的技術如JSP,Servlet,SSM框架等,主要針對于Web應用程序開發
JavaME(Java Micro Edition):微型版

4.Java JDK

JDK 是用于開發和運行 Java 程序的軟件。

<1>安裝

下載官網:https://www.oracle.com/technetwork/java/javase/overview/index.html
安裝默認路徑:C:\Program Files\Java\jdk1.8.0_77
環境配置:

JAVA_HOME C:\Program Files\Java\jdk1.8.0_77 //java安裝路徑 CLASSPATH .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ar //java的類庫 Path %JAVA_HOME%\bin;%JAVA_HOME%\jre\bin //包含java運行文件

檢查是否安裝成功,Win+R輸入CMD打開命令窗口
輸入java -version可以顯示當前版本信息,則安裝成功

各個文件的介紹
文件夾作用
bin存放Java開發工具 Binary二進制 編譯javac.exe 運行java.exe 只能命令行使用
db數據庫支持文件DataBase
include底層C語言支持,因為JVM是C寫的
jre運行環境
libjar文件,支持Java語言開發核心類庫 Library jar包
src源代碼包壓縮包文件
javafx-src新一代的Java圖形化界面開發工具包 編譯AWT Swing
<2>配置環境變量

方法一:
打開環境變量設置:此電腦→屬性→高級系統設置→環境變量
在環境變量中系統變量 Path下添加C:\Program Files\Java\jdk1.8.0_77\bin
方法二:
提示:在安裝MySQL數據庫,或者Eclipse,或者Tomacat服務器的時候
創建新的系統變量:JAVA_HOME
為JAVA_HOME添加變量值:JDK的安裝目錄
將Path換將中新建 %JAVA_HOME%\bin

5.關鍵術語
英文中文
Application Program Interface ( API)應用程序接口
assembler(匯編器
assembly language匯編語言
bit比特
block
block comment塊注釋
bus總線
byte字節
bytecode字節碼
bytecode verifier字節碼驗證器
cable modem電纜調制解調器
Central Processing Unit (CPU)中央處理器
class loader類加載器
comment(注釋
compiler(編譯器
console控制臺
dot pitch點距
DSL ( Digital Subscriber Line )數字用戶線
encoding scheme編碼規范
hardware硬件
high-level language高級語言
Integreted Development Environment ( IDE〉集成開發環境
interpreter解釋器
java commandjava 命令
Java Development Toolkit (JDK)Java 開發工具包
Java language specificationJava 語言規范
Java Virtual Machine (JVM)Java 虛擬機
javac commandjavac 命令
keyword or reserved word關鍵字或保留字
library
line comment行注釋
logic error邏輯錯誤
low-level language低級語言
machine language機器語言
main methodmain 方法
memory內存
modem調制解調器
motherboard主板
Network Interface Card ( NIC)網絡接口卡
Operation System (OS)操作系統
pixel像素
program程序
programming程序設計
runtime error運行時錯誤
screen resolution屏幕分辨率
software軟件
source code源代碼
source program源程序
statement語句
statement terminator語句結束符
storage device存儲設備
syntax error語法錯誤
二、計算機基礎
1.計算機軟件與硬件

計算機硬件(ComputerHardware):是指計算機系統中,由電子,機械和光電元件組成的各種物理裝置的總稱。這些物理裝置按照系統結構的要求構成一個有機整體為計算機軟件運行提供物質基礎。
計算機通常由CPU、主板、內存、電源、主機箱、硬盤、顯卡、鍵盤、鼠標、顯示器等多個部件組成。
計算機軟件(ComputerSoftware):是指使用計算機過程中必不可少的東西,計算機軟件可以使計算機按照事先預定好的順序完成特定的功能,計算機軟件按照其功能劃分為系統軟件與應用軟件。
系統軟件:DOS(Disk Operating System),Windows,Linux,Unix,Max,Android,IOS
應用軟件:微信,抖音,支付寶

2.人機交互

軟件的出現實現了人與計算機之間更好的交互。
交互方式
圖形化界面:這種方式簡單直觀,使用者易于接受,容易上手操作。
命令行方式:需要有一個控制臺,輸入特定的指令,讓計算機完成一些操作。較為麻煩,需要記住一些命令

3.鍵盤功能鍵和快捷鍵
快捷鍵功能
Ctrl+A全選
Ctrl+C復制
Ctrl+V粘貼
Ctrl+X剪切
Ctrl+W關閉選項卡/窗口
Ctrl+P打印
Ctrl+F查找
Ctrl+N新建文件
Win+E打開資源管理器
Win+R打開運行窗口
Win+I打開Windows設置
Win+P打開投影模式
Win+D快速切換桌面
Win+L快速鎖屏
Alt+F4強制關閉程序
Shift+Delete強制刪除,不走回收站
Tab制表符/自動補全
4.常見的DOS命令講解
命令功能
D:盤符切換
dir列出當前目錄下的文件以及文件夾
md創建目錄
rd刪除目錄
cd改變指定目錄(進入目錄)
cd…退回上級目錄
cd/退回到根目錄
del刪除文件
exit退出dos命令行
cls清屏
notepad記事本
mspaint畫圖板
calc計算機
rd /s詢問刪除
rd /q /s直接刪除
三、Java語言基礎
1.第一個程序(Hello world)
class HelloWorld{public static void main(String[] args) {System.out.println("Hellow world!");} }
2.常見錯誤
常見錯誤建議
語法錯誤仔細檢查代碼
運行時錯誤檢查代碼邏輯
邏輯錯誤需求與結果不符 檢查代碼邏輯和需求邏輯
擴展名被隱藏打開文件擴展名顯示
文件名和類名不一致編寫代碼使類名和文件名一致
嚴格區分大小寫
出現中文標點符號
遺漏括號
遺漏分號
遺漏引號
命名拼寫錯誤

總結

以上是生活随笔為你收集整理的Java SE 01 Java概述的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。